Problem Note 14451: PROC BOXPLOT abends with a single group having a date format
If your group variable has only one numeric value and that variable has
a SAS date format associated with it, PROC BOXPLOT will abend with:
ERROR: Floating Point Zero Divide.
ERROR: Termination due to Floating Point Exception
To circumvent this problem, use a character group variable instead. The
PUT function can be used in a DATA step to create a character version of
the numeric group variable with the desired format.
Operating System and Release Information
SAS System | SAS/STAT | Microsoft Windows XP Professional | 9 TS M0 | 9.2 TS2M0 |
Microsoft Windows NT Workstation | 9 TS M0 | |
Microsoft® Windows® for 64-Bit Itanium-based Systems | 9 TS M0 | 9.2 TS2M0 |
Microsoft Windows Server 2003 Standard Edition | 9 TS M0 | 9.2 TS2M0 |
Microsoft Windows Server 2003 Datacenter Edition | 9 TS M0 | 9.2 TS2M0 |
Microsoft Windows Server 2003 Enterprise Edition | 9 TS M0 | 9.2 TS2M0 |
AIX | 9 TS M0 | |
Microsoft Windows 2000 Server | 9 TS M0 | 9.2 TS2M0 |
Microsoft Windows 2000 Professional | 9 TS M0 | 9.2 TS2M0 |
Microsoft Windows 2000 Datacenter Server | 9 TS M0 | 9.2 TS2M0 |
64-bit Enabled Solaris | 9 TS M0 | 9.2 TS2M0 |
Solaris | 9 TS M0 | 9.2 TS2M0 |
Microsoft Windows 2000 Advanced Server | 9 TS M0 | 9.2 TS2M0 |
z/OS | 9 TS M0 | 9.2 TS2M0 |
Linux | 9 TS M0 | 9.2 TS2M0 |
HP-UX IPF | 9 TS M0 | 9.2 TS2M0 |
HP-UX | 9 TS M0 | 9.2 TS2M0 |
Linux on Itanium | 9.1 TS1M3 | 9.2 TS2M0 |
64-bit Enabled HP-UX | 9 TS M0 | 9.2 TS2M0 |
64-bit Enabled AIX | 9 TS M0 | |
OpenVMS Alpha | 9 TS M0 | 9.2 TS2M0 |
Tru64 UNIX | 9 TS M0 | 9.2 TS2M0 |
*
For software releases that are not yet generally available, the Fixed
Release is the software release in which the problem is planned to be
fixed.
Type: | Problem Note |
Priority: | |
Topic: | SAS Reference ==> Procedures ==> BOXPLOT Analytics ==> Descriptive Statistics
|
Date Modified: | 2005-02-04 08:16:32 |
Date Created: | 2005-01-31 15:29:28 |